- 5
- 0
- 约6.83千字
- 约 28页
- 2017-03-17 发布于北京
- 举报
第12章 网络程序设计技术(1学时) computercenter.jlu.edu.cn 第12章 网络程序设计技术 12.1.1 文件的只读与可修改 12.1.1 文件的只读与可修改 12.1.1 文件的只读与可修改 12.1.2 文件的独占与共享 12.1.2 文件的独占与共享 12.1.2 文件的独占与共享 12.1.2 文件的独占与共享 12.1.3 要求独占打开文件的命令 12.1.3 要求独占打开文件的命令 12.1.3 要求独占打开文件的命令 12.2 共享数据锁机制 12.2.1 记录加锁 12.2.1 记录加锁 12.2.1 记录加锁 12.2.2 文件加锁函数 12.2.3 受锁机制影响的命令 12.2.3 受锁机制影响的命令 12.2.3 受锁机制影响的命令 12.2.3 受锁机制影响的命令 12.2.3 受锁机制影响的命令 12.2.3 受锁机制影响的命令 12.2.4 释放锁 12.2.4 释放锁 12.2.4 释放锁 12.3 网络程序出错处理 computercenter.jlu.edu.cn * / 41 吉林大学计算机教学与研究中心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 网络应用程序的主要特点 :多个程序并行执行,多个用户同时访问数据库。 网络程序要解决的关键问题:数据共享与数据访问冲突。 VFP网络编程机制:文件共享和数据加锁。 文件打开方式:是否允许修改文件—以只读方式打开;是否允许多个用户同时访问文件—以独占方式打开。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 2.以只读方式打开的文件类型:数据库文件(DBC)、表文件(DBF)、文本文件(TXT)和程序文件(PRG、QPR、MPR) 1. 通过菜单设置只读打开方式:文件菜单→打开;在打开对话框中选择文件类型→文件名;选定以只读方式打开,单击确定按钮。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 3.通过命令设置只读打开方式: (1)打开数据库文件: Open DataBase 数据库名 [ NoUpdate ] Modify database NoEdit (2)打开表文件: Use 表文件名 [ NoUpdate ] (3)打开文本文件: Modify File 文本文件名 [ NoModify ] (4)打开程序文件: Modify Command 程序文件名 [ NoModify ]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 4.以只读方式打开文件的目的:限制修改文件中的内容。 特殊性:以只读方式打开据库,而以可修改方式打开其中的表,则执行MODIFY DATABASE NOEDIT,在数据库设计器中不能修改表结构及其相关信息 ,可修改表中的数据记录。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 共享打开方式 :用户打开文件后,允许其他用户以同种方式打开该文件 。 独占打开方式 :用户打开文件后,其他用户无法以任何方式打开该文件 。 通过菜单设置独占/共享:文件菜单→打开;在打开对话框中选择文件类型→文件名;选定独占,单击确定按钮。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d
原创力文档

文档评论(0)